    You must visit the Linlithgow Palace! The streets in Linlithgow are walkable, so that's nice. Be aware whenever you are anywhere in Scotland on a Monday, restaurants and shops may be closed (I ran into this all over each Monday). Otherwise, Linlithgow is a quaint town with rich history. Go!

    Unfortunately the magnificent Palace was closed for repairs but the loch, town and canal were as lovely as ever. I have previously stayed in Linlithgow and remember it well from my boyhood in Edinburgh. The glorious cities of Edinburgh, Glasgow and Stirling are quickly reached by train but Linlithgow is of course well worth visiting in its own right. You will soon find your own favourite cafes and restaurants and remember the unique sound of car tyres on cobbled streets! So get your morninng rolls and come here. Enjoy.

    A great place to enjoy walking around and to follow the trails offered. The Palace and the Peel, the loch and the pavement cafes were our favourites. We had some take-away and also a meal in the Star and Garter but there was really so much choice of eating places it depended on how busy it was at certain times. Unfortunately, the Palace was undergoing some building work so was not open. It is worth walking up to see the Union Canal basin, all run by volunteers. It is a friendly and welcoming town.
